Hey,
I am getting my vpp stuff in tomorrow. Tonight I was working with the servo and throttle for the vpp. I am totally new at this heli mode stuff and so far with my Futaba 9C I have got this:
At middle throttle the throttle is turned off. Above middle throttle is where the prop will turn the regular way for normal flight. When I pull the stick back below mid ways it will give it throttle plus reverse the pitch of the prop. So far that is what I have. I am wondering if I am doing this right. Also is there a way I can have a switch for this. So if I flip the switch I will have the setup above and when I flip the switch again it will go to normal mode where when your throttle is all the way back your motor is off and all the way up is full throttle. Please let me know cause I hope to be able to try it out tomorrow!!!!!!!

yes you can, set the plane up in the tranny as a HELI, this way you can set both the throttle ( revs ) and pitch in the relevant curves in the idle ups. read your manual on setting idle ups on a heli, and all should become clear.

Page 85 in the Futaba 9c Instruction Manual.
Its called "Idle-Up", controlled by switch G if you have a9CA or Switch E on the 9CH.
Flip it one way for normal, the other way for VPP.
